Kenya names strong team, eyes to recapture men's marathon gold at Commonwealth Games

NAIROBI, Jan. 16 (Xinhua) -- Kenya has named a strong team as they seek revenge and recapture the men's marathon title at the Gold Coast Commonwealth Games in April 4-15 in Australia.

Ironically, it was Australian Michael Shelley, who had won silver in 2010 in Delhi, who denied Kenya the chance to ascend to the throne when he won gold in Cardiff, Wales.

Now Kenya is out to recapture the title and fend off any pretenders to the throne as it named a strong six-member team for the Club Games.

Leading Kenya's quest will be Kenneth Mburu, Nicholas Kamacha, and Julius Nderitu in the men's race while Shelmith Muriuki, Hellen Nzembi and Sheilah Jerotich face the hard task to successfully defend Kenya's gold and silver medals won by Flomena Cheyech and Caroline Kemboi respectively in the 2014 games in Glasgow, Scotland in 2014.

"I believe this team will be able to battle the other teams and excel," Paul Mutwii, the Athletics Kenya Vice President who is in charge of competitions, said on Tuesday.

"They have been notified and all have accepted to take the challenge and represent the country," he added.
